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 10 ACMG points: 10P and 0B. PM2PM5PP3_StrongPP5_Moderate
The NM_000169.3(GLA):c.154T>G(p.Cys52Gly)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ely pathogenic (★).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. C52S) has been classified as Likely pathogenic.

Variant summary: GLA c.154T>G (p.Cys52Gly) results in a non-conservative amino acid change in the encoded protein sequence. Five of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ant was absent in 183425 control chromosomes (gnomAD). c.154T>G has been reported in the literature in individuals affected with Fabry Disease (Benjamin_2017, Cruz_2011, Warnock_2012). These data indicate that the variant may be associated with disease. In addition, other missense changes at this position, C52R, C52S, C52W, C52Y, and nearby, F50C, M51I, M51K, N53D, N53K, have been reported to be associated with Fabry Disease. Therefore, suggesting this region is important for protein function.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. No cl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as likely pathogenic. -
